OSHC and the Australian Health Care System

The Australian healthcare system may be different to that in your home country.

Find out what to do if you get sick. If you live in Adelaide for an extended time, you should know how your Overseas Student Health Cover (OSHC) works with our healthcare system.

It is a condition of your student visa to have Overseas Student Health Cover (OSHC) insurance for the entire length of your stay. OSHC covers all public hospitals in Adelaide. OSHC can cover many of your medical expenses if you become sick or injured.

You can get OSHC coverage from many different providers. The University's preferred provider is Medibank.
